Abstract

This chapter addresses the problems of delay-dependent robust passivity analysis and passification for uncertain MJLs with time-varying delay. First, we will introduce the definitions of being passive and robustly passive. By using the slack matrix approach and the LMI technique, we will characterize the passivity for the uncertain MJLs. Then the robust passification problem is also solved.
